PHILIPS N 2229 SYNC.SOUND CASSETTE RECORDER
and SYNPUTER TWO-BAND SYNCHRONIZER PACKAGE

 

This is a sync.sound cassette recorder suitable for all 8mm or 16mm film cameras, the Philips AV-N 2229 Sync. uses the 1Khz impulse system which is fairly simple in use but highly precise in 2-band filming/sync.sound recording.

 

Any film camera equipt with a sync.flash output socket or any pro 16mm camera which has a quartz controlled motor can be used with the Philips AV-N2229 recorder and the Synputer system.

 

Just like the Nagra SN which uses mono 1/8" tape, the Philips N 2229 uses the same 1/8" tape in the standard cassette cartridges, thus eliminating fussy on/off loading of the material. And again like the Nagra SN, this is a full coat mono sound recorder, running one way only. This means that unlike music cassettes you won't be able to switch sides and record on the reverse direction.

 

Like all sync.sound recorders, the sound is recorded on one channel and the reference information on the other, which will be needed to synchronize the recorder with projectors or other editing equipment required for a synchronous screening or dubbing.

 

The Philips AV-N 2229 records at a speed twice as high as the normal music cassette recorders, speed is 9.5cm/s. This is required for the editing process and to keep the sound quality at it's best and at same quality as the 1/4" professional studio recorders.
